Demographics Overview
When examining the user demographics of Blockworks, several key trends emerge:
Age Distribution
The majority of Blockworks users are young adults, with a significant portion falling within the 18-34 age bracket. This demographic is highly tech-savvy and open to exploring new technologies. Their enthusiasm for blockchain is driven by a desire to stay ahead of technological advancements and participate in emerging markets.
Geographic Distribution
Blockworks users are spread across various regions around the world. While some countries have a higher concentration of users due to their early adoption rates, there is a noticeable global interest in blockchain technology. This indicates that Blockworks has successfully tapped into an international market.
Educational Background
The educational background of Blockworks users varies significantly. Many are professionals from various industries who are interested in leveraging blockchain for business or personal use. Others are students and enthusiasts who are passionate about learning more about this groundbreaking technology.
